On the mechanism of the isospin fractionation in nuclear multifragmentation

Description
The isospin fractionation in heavy-ion collisions is investigated using a static method and an isospin-dependent quantum molecular dynamics (IQMD) model. A static interpretation of the isospin fractionation is provided based on a phenomenological asymmetric nuclear equation of state. The effects of different dynamic ingredients on the isospin fractionation, i.e. symmetry potential. Coulomb potential and isospin dependence of N-N cross section, are discussed in the frame of IQMD model
